Abstract
The present invention discloses a kind of stroke patient wheeled walking aids,Including upper bracket,The lower carriage being flexibly connected by connector with upper bracket,Both sides are connected with handle and chest-protector plate on upper bracket,Both sides are connected with lumbar support plate above upper bracket,Upper bracket upper center is connected with seat,Upper bracket is connected with buttocks support frame by seat support rack side,Upper bracket is provided with gas spring mechanism with lower carriage junction side,The connecting tube base connection of lower carriage lower end,Connecting tube base is placed on the first bearing,First bearing medial surface is connected with the second bearing,Adjusting rod is connected between second bearing of lower carriage two sides,Second bearing is provided with pedal,The device for rehabilitation of the present invention is used to help stroke patient Walking,Acupoint stimulation is carried out to patient by channels and collaterals massage,Improve training quality,Training component surface coats non-skid coating,Avoiding patient, slideway occurs surprisingly in the training process,The strength that patient can utilize upper limbs and waist to swing reaches the purpose of walking.

Technical field
The invention belongs to rehabilitation training equipment field, and in particular to a kind of stroke patient wheeled walking aids.
Background technology
Apoplexy is one of No.1 formidable enemy of serious threat human health, and the limb movement disturbance triggered after apoplexy is even more to disease
People and family bring very big pain.Because nervous centralis conduction is not smooth, patient's walking can not receive brain control.Such patient
Step is dragged forward in the form of making an arc with the help of being substantially layman or medical personnel.It is difficult to leave other people in walking process
Help or need the assistive devices such as crutch to walk.Therefore, during rehabilitation Walking household and patient need to pay it is huge
Big energy and time, and usually get half the result with twice the effort, produce effects bad.
Prior art, such as Chinese invention granted patent document, the B of Authorization Notice No. CN 101933877, the invention is a
Help the initiative rehabilitation machinery of walking disorder patient, the patients such as hemiplegia, paraplegia can be helped to carry out ambulation training, and equipped with seat and
Lifting system, patient can be helped easily to stand, it is not necessary to consume excessive muscle power, and patient can utilize upper limbs and waist to put
Dynamic strength reaches the purpose of walking, but the machinery only helps patient to walk by mechanical training, is improving patient
Also there is certain room for promotion in terms of resume speed and quality;Such as prior art, Chinese invention publication, application publication number
The A of CN 106137497, the device can be such that children mechanically train repeatedly to help children with cerebral palsy to carry out sitting posture, stance and walking
Auxiliary rehabilitation exercise, in addition can also correcting X-shaped and " O " shape leg, but how to improve children in children training process
Training effectiveness, can also be further perfect in terms of shortening rehabilitation duration.

Preferably, gas spring mechanism includes gas spring, and gas spring is placed in support two sides by fixed plate and supporting plate,
Fixed plate is connected with upper bracket lower end side, and supporting plate is connected with lower carriage upper side, and gas spring is connected with control line, control
Line is connected with the control handle below handle, and patient's training effect is further lifted by gas spring mechanism, gas spring mechanism
Control handle can realize that patient is sitting in the regulation of height on device for rehabilitation or helps patient stand, can be for patient in the training process
The physical demands in addition to leg training is saved, is advantageous to improve patient's training effect.
Preferably, pedal surface is provided with channels and collaterals massager, and channels and collaterals massager passes through data wire and the controller of handle side
Connection, with digital technology, is changed into accurate digital signal by the physical agent needed for patient, then by computer according to patient
Need to carry out complex treatment, treatment is accurate, and channels and collaterals massager, which can carry out patient acupoint stimulation, to be helped quickly to improve patient's
Rehabilitation efficacy, patient can select stimulus intensity by controller, simple and convenient.
Preferably, handle, knee-pad, pedal, seat surface are coated with non-skid coating, and non-skid coating is by following component and again
Measure part composition:Epoxy resin latex 60-84 parts, acrylonitrile-butadiene-styrene copolymer 2-6 parts, nano silicon 11-
14 parts, Sodium Polyacrylate 0.6-1.2 parts, chlorinated paraffin 6-7 parts, diphenyl isooctyl phosphate 0.2-0.34 parts, wetting agent 0.5-
0.8 part, dispersant 2-3 parts, OPEO 0.6-0.9 parts, ethylenediamine 0.1-0.5 parts, propane diols 4-8 parts, water 15-
20 parts, the solid content of epoxy resin latex is 68%~74%, wetting agent GSK-588, GSK-582 or GSK-585, dispersant
It is one or more for sodium pyrophosphate, zinc stearate, diethyl zinc, in handle, knee-pad, pedal, seat surface coating non-skid coating
And the above-mentioned part after drying and processing can effectively prevent patient and perspire in the training process to cause the wet and slippery patient of above-mentioned part
Slip or the generation of other accidents, improve above-mentioned part and the frictional force of patient contacting position, improve training effect,
Due to nano silicon nano grain surface product and surface tension it is very big, easily mutually reunite and it is ineffective influence it is anti-skidding
The effect of coating, effectively prevent the nano particle of nano silicon from reuniting by adding diphenyl isooctyl phosphate, but
Its mechanism of action is still not clear, and need further to study, while the non-skid coating of the present invention also has excellent weatherability, resisted
Fragility, moisture-proof, tensile strength are high.
